Mastering Prefire Angles: The Ultimate Guide to Getting Ahead of Your Opponents
In the world of competitive gaming, mastering prefire angles is essential for gaining a tactical advantage over your opponents. Prefiring involves anticipating your enemy's position and firing before they even appear on your screen. This technique not only catches opponents off guard but also increases your chances of securing kills. To excel at this, players must familiarize themselves with the maps, identifying common hiding spots and chokepoints where opponents tend to congregate. Start by studying pro players and their movement patterns, noting how and when they opt to prefire.
To effectively implement prefire angles in your gameplay, consider these essential tips:
- Map Awareness: Know each map's layout and key areas where players are likely to engage.
- Positioning: Always position yourself where you have the upper hand.
- Timing: Understand the rhythm of engagements; predict when enemies might appear.
- Practice: Use custom games to hone your reflexes and perfect your timing on prefire angles.

Top 5 Prefire Angles That Will Make Your Enemies Rage Quit
In the world of competitive gaming, mastering the art of prefire can give you a significant edge over your opponents. Here are the Top 5 Prefire Angles that will not only enhance your gameplay but potentially make your enemies rage quit in frustration. First up, consider the corner peeking technique. This involves anticipating enemy movements by pre-firing at commonly used corners where players tend to camp. Not only will this give you the first shot advantage, but it will also catch your adversaries off guard, throwing them into a panic.
Another effective angle is the long sightlines. Maps often have specific areas where players can be spotted from a distance. Learning to prefire these sightlines with precision can lead to quick eliminations, causing enemies to rethink their approach. Additionally, using pre-aim spots where you know enemies will appear can greatly increase your kill rate. By incorporating these tactics into your gameplay, you'll instill a sense of dread in your opponents, pushing them closer to that inevitable rage quit.
How to Utilize Prefire Angles for Maximum Frustration: Tips and Techniques
When mastering the art of utilizing prefire angles for maximum frustration, it's essential to understand the dynamics of shooter mechanics. First, consider positioning yourself at strategic points on the map where opponents are likely to appear. This tactic will allow you to anticipate their movements and fire ahead of their arrival, increasing your chances of a successful hit. You can use tools like custom game modes to practice your timing and precision. Here are some key tips to keep in mind:
- Familiarize yourself with common choke points on the map.
- Aim for headshot zones to maximize damage.
- Practice tracking moving targets to refine your reaction time.
Another critical aspect of using prefire angles effectively is the element of surprise. By consistently altering your firing locations and timing, you will create a psychological effect that frustrates opponents and forces them into unpredictable behaviors. Consider employing bait and switch tactics, where you appear to engage in a different area before quickly repositioning to your pre-aimed angle. This can lead to confusion and, ultimately, a tactical advantage. Always remember that:
- Patience is key; don’t shoot too early or allow your enemy to regroup.
- Communicate with your team to coordinate angles.
- Take note of enemy habits for more effective pre-firing.
